Texas Instruments (TI) has several recent significant developments: - TI's CEO, Haviv Ilan, will speak at the UBS investor conference on December 3, 2024[1]. - TI opened a new product distribution center near Frankfurt, Germany, enhancing delivery times in Europe[1]. - TI received up to $1.6 billion in proposed funding from the CHIPS and Science Act for new 300mm semiconductor wafer fabs in Texas and Utah[2]. - TI reported Q3 2024 revenue of $4.15 billion, with net income of $1.36 billion and earnings per share of $1.47[3]. - The company declared a quarterly cash dividend of $1.36 per share for Q4 2024[5].
Texas Instruments has secured up to $1.6 billion in proposed funding from the CHIPS and Science Act to support the construction of three new 300mm semiconductor wafer fabs in Texas and Utah, part of an $18 billion investment through 2029 to enhance domestic semiconductor manufacturing and create over 2,000 jobs[1][2].
Texas Instruments introduced two new series of real-time microcontrollers, the TMS320F28P55x and F29H85x, enhancing system efficiency, safety, and sustainability in automotive and industrial applications. The TMS320F28P55x series includes an edge AI hardware accelerator with up to 99% fault detection accuracy, while the F29H85x series more than doubles real-time control performance and meets safety standards up to ASIL D and SIL 3[1].
